Program Manager | Mary Free Bed & Carle Health

Mary Free Bed Rehabilitation Hospital is a healthcare provider focused on rehabilitation services. The Program Manager will be responsible for ensuring quality patient care and effective management of a multidisciplinary team, while also overseeing staff development and operational responsibilities.

Health CareHospital

Responsibilities

Ensures that appropriate standards of care are consistently met within assigned areas, aligning with hospital goals, policies, and procedures. This includes maintaining clinical standards, mentoring staff, and ensuring compliance with accreditation agencies (e.g., MDPH, CARF). Responsible for ensuring adequate staffing, equipment, and supplies to meet patient needs
Maintains up-to-date knowledge of trends and best practices in rehabilitation. Builds and sustains professional relationships with peers and external colleagues to support continuous learning and innovation
Contributes to the development of productivity goals and monitors staff performance to ensure targets are met. Provides data and insights to support budget planning and resource allocation
Leads recruitment, hiring, orientation, and training of new staff. Oversees daily operations of clinical and coverage service staff. Provides regular performance feedback, sets measurable goals, and conducts formal evaluations
Oversees onboarding and ongoing professional development of staff. Promotes a culture of continuous learning through formal and informal education, using competency-based systems to support growth
Identifies areas for improvement and implements solutions to enhance care delivery. Actively supports initiatives to improve patient and family satisfaction and participates in departmental quality monitoring efforts
Fosters a culture of accountability, respect, open communication, adaptability, and pride. Encourages team members to embrace change and contribute positively to the work environment
Promotes effective collaboration across departments and disciplines. Maintains strong working relationships with medical directors and admitting physicians. Participates in or leads team meetings, physician conferences, task forces, and other collaborative forums
Supports the development and implementation of clinical policies, procedures, and protocols. Participates in marketing initiatives and maintains relationships with referral sources. Leads or coordinates special projects and community engagement events as assigned
Demonstrate excellent customer service and standards of behaviors as well as encourages, coaches, and monitors the same in team members. This individual should consistently promote teamwork and direct communication with co-workers and deal discretely and sensitively with confidential information
Contribute by identifying problems and seeking solutions. Promote patient/family satisfaction where possible; participates in departmental efforts to monitor and report customer service

Required

Bachelor's degree in Healthcare Administration, or a related field, or significant experience required
Graduate of an accredited program in Physical Therapy, Occupational Therapy, Nursing, Recreational Therapy, or Speech-Language Pathology. Graduates of accredited PTA or COTA programs will also be considered
Current licensure or eligibility for licensure in the State of service in the relevant clinical discipline
Current CPR certification in accordance with departmental and program protocols
Minimum of four (4) years of professional experience in a clinical rehabilitation setting
Demonstrated expertise in a specific diagnostic area of rehabilitation (e.g., neuro, ortho, pediatrics, geriatrics)
Strong leadership capabilities with experience supervising students, clinical staff, or interdisciplinary teams
Effective decision-making skills with the ability to manage complex clinical and operational situations
Excellent time management and organizational skills, with the ability to prioritize and manage multiple responsibilities
Exceptional ver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to interact effectively with patients, families, and healthcare professionals
Proficient in data interpretation, reporting, and presentation to support program development and performance improvement
Competency in using information systems and technology to support clinical and administrative functions

Preferred

Master's degree in related field preferred
A minimum of two years of relevant clinical experience required and direct supervision of clinical staff preferred
Experience with government reimbursement systems and other regulatory bodies related to service line
Demonstrates competence in relevant software and hardware required to meet job responsibilities
